What’s the Difference Between a Broker and an Exchange?

Understanding the distinction between a crypto broker and a crypto exchange is crucial for aligning your choice with your experience level and trading preferences.

A broker acts as an intermediary, allowing users to buy and sell crypto at fixed prices. This model is beginner-friendly, offering simple interfaces and multiple payment options like SEPA, credit cards, or PayPal. However, brokers typically charge higher fees and offer less price control due to fixed spreads.

An exchange, in contrast, enables peer-to-peer trading through order books. Users place limit or market orders, benefiting from lower fees and greater control over trade execution. While exchanges are ideal for experienced traders, they can be overwhelming for newcomers due to complex interfaces and market volatility.

Binance – Global Powerhouse with EU Regulation

Binance is one of the world’s largest crypto exchanges by volume and is regulated in multiple European countries, including France, Italy, and Lithuania.

Features & Functionality

Supports over 600 cryptocurrencies and offers spot trading, futures, staking, margin trading, and a peer-to-peer marketplace. Users can deposit via SEPA, Visa, Mastercard, Apple Pay, and Google Pay. Binance also issues a crypto debit card and supports leveraged tokens.

Security & Regulation

Regulated under EU VASP frameworks. Implements AES-256 encryption, biometric login, two-factor authentication (2FA), and stores most funds in cold wallets. The SAFU (Secure Asset Fund for Users) backs user assets with 10% of trading fees.

Fees

User Experience

Offers both “Lite” (beginner) and “Pro” (advanced) modes. The mobile app is intuitive and supports seamless switching between modes.

Support

Includes a help center, AI chatbot, and ticket system—though response times can be slow.

Binance suits both new and experienced traders seeking a wide array of features and strong security backed by global scale.

Coinbase – Trusted U.S. Giant with German BaFin License

Coinbase is one of the most recognized names in crypto and holds the distinction of being the first exchange licensed by Germany’s BaFin.

Features & Functionality

Offers over 240 cryptocurrencies and 22 stablecoins (maker fees waived). Supports SEPA, Sofort, PayPal, Apple Pay, and credit cards. All assets are withdrawable to personal wallets—no “trade-only” restrictions.

Advanced tools include Coinbase Earn (learn & earn), staking rewards, free TradingView charts on “Advanced Trade,” and Coinbase One ($29.99/month) for zero trading fees (standard) and 25% off advanced fees.

Security & Regulation

Licensed in multiple EU countries including Spain, Italy, Sweden, and Poland. Holds 98% of assets in cold storage. Trusted by institutions like BlackRock and Grayscale. Mandatory 2FA for all accounts.

Fees

User Experience

Clean, intuitive UI with smooth navigation between beginner and pro modes. Seamless integration with Coinbase Wallet.

Support

24/7 live chat, email support, phone support during business hours, and a dedicated hotline for security issues.

Coinbase stands out for its regulatory credibility, ease of use, and institutional-grade security—ideal for both beginners and pros.

Kraken – Veteran Exchange with No Major Hacks

Founded in 2011, Kraken is one of the oldest and most trusted exchanges globally.

Features & Functionality

Offers over 185 cryptocurrencies, margin trading (up to 5x), futures (up to 50x leverage), SEPA deposits (free), and support for USD, EUR, GBP, JPY, CHF, CAD, AUD.

Security & Regulation

Licensed in the UK (FCA), Italy (VASP), and the U.S. (MSB). Uses 95% cold storage, 2FA, withdrawal whitelisting, and email confirmations.

Fees

User Experience

Two interfaces: “Standard” for beginners; “Pro” for advanced traders with real-time charting tools.

Support

Email, phone support (EU/US), chatbot, and educational resources.

Kraken excels in security reputation and transparency—perfect for serious traders.

Bitpanda – Austrian Broker with Diverse Asset Access

Founded in 2014 in Austria, Bitpanda is a leading European broker offering more than just crypto.

Features & Functionality

Trades over 2,700 assets, including stocks, ETFs (with dividends), metals, and 200+ cryptocurrencies. Offers the BEST token for cashback, staking bonuses, and rewards.

Security & Regulation

Licensed under MiFID-II, PSD2 e-money license, and VAP status across Germany, France, Italy, UK, Czechia, Sweden.

Uses multi-sig wallets, SOC2-compliant audits, regular pentests.

Fees

Broker fees ~1.49% for Bitcoin; lower on Bitpanda Pro (exchange mode).

Some altcoins cannot be withdrawn after purchase—a notable limitation.

Bitpanda shines in product diversity but charges higher broker fees.


Bitvavo – Dutch Exchange with Transparent Pricing

Based in Amsterdam since 2018.

Features & Functionality

Over 300 digital assets, staking support. Payment options: SEPA, Giropay, MyBank.

Security & Regulation

Registered with Dutch Central Bank (DNB); also reported in Austria, France, Italy. Funds held in trust via Stichting Bitvavo Payments.

Cold storage + insured custodians + multi-sig + 2FA.

Fees

Between 0.15%–0.25%, decreasing with higher volume.

Bitvavo offers a solid balance of low fees and regulatory compliance—great for casual traders.


Bitstamp – One of Europe’s Oldest Exchanges

Founded in 2011 in Luxembourg.

Features & Functionality

Simple spot trading with ~70 cryptocurrencies; supports staking/lending but no derivatives.

SEPA and card deposits supported; OTC desk available.

Security & Regulation

Regulated by FCA (UK), CSSF (Luxembourg), MFSA (Malta), FSMA (Belgium), plus Italy/Sweden/Spain/Poland.

Cold storage + bug bounty program + regular audits + multi-sig + 2FA.

Fees

Starts at 0.5% for low-volume traders; decreases with volume.

Ideal for users wanting basic functionality with long-standing credibility.


Bison – Germany’s First Regulated Crypto App

Operated by Boerse Stuttgart Digital Broker GmbH.

Features & Functionality

Only 27 cryptocurrencies, but includes BTC/ETH/LTC/DOGE. Offers price alerts and tax reports. Free demo mode available.

Security & Regulation

Fully regulated in Germany; assets held separately with custody via Boerse Stuttgart Digital Custody GmbH. Cold storage + deposit protection.

No transaction or withdrawal fees—only a 1.25% spread on trades.

Highly intuitive app perfect for German-speaking beginners seeking safety over choice.

Do Crypto Exchanges Report to Tax Authorities?

Yes—under the upcoming EU DAC-8 directive, all regulated "Crypto-Asset Service Providers" (CASPs) like Coinbase, Bitpanda, Binance (via French license), Bitstamp must report user data to tax authorities to combat tax evasion. Platforms without EU licenses may not be subject to this rule yet—but compliance is expanding rapidly across Europe.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Are all listed exchanges fully legal in the EU?
A: Yes—all platforms are registered or licensed under EU financial regulators such as BaFin (Germany), DNB (Netherlands), CSSF (Luxembourg), or FCA (UK).

Q: Which exchange has the lowest fees?
A: Binance and Bitvavo offer some of the lowest spot trading fees starting at 0.1%–0.15%, especially for high-volume traders.

Q: Can I withdraw my crypto to my personal wallet?
A: Most platforms allow withdrawals—exceptions include certain altcoins on Bitpanda or broker-mode assets on some platforms unless moved to pro/exchange mode.

Q: Is KYC required?
A: Yes—regulated exchanges require identity verification under AML laws before enabling deposits or trades above small limits.

Q: Which platform is best for beginners?
A: Bison and Coinbase offer the most intuitive interfaces with strong educational resources—perfect for first-time buyers.

Q: What happens if an exchange gets hacked?
A: Regulated platforms like Coinbase or Kraken protect user funds via insurance funds (e.g., SAFU) or cold storage policies that minimize exposure during breaches.
